Benefits of Hydroxypropylmethylcellulose in Eye Drops

Hydroxypropylmethylcellulose, also known as HPMC, is a commonly used ingredient in eye drops. It is a type of cellulose derivative that is water-soluble and has a variety of beneficial properties for the eyes. In this article, we will explore the benefits of hydroxypropylmethylcellulose in eye drops and how it can help improve eye health.

One of the main benefits of hydroxypropylmethylcellulose in eye drops is its ability to provide lubrication and moisture to the eyes. This is especially important for individuals who suffer from dry eye syndrome, a condition in which the eyes do not produce enough tears or the tears evaporate too quickly. By using eye drops that contain hydroxypropylmethylcellulose, individuals can help alleviate the symptoms of dry eye and improve their overall eye comfort.

In addition to providing lubrication, hydroxypropylmethylcellulose also helps to protect the eyes from irritation and inflammation. This is because it forms a protective barrier on the surface of the eye, preventing foreign particles and allergens from coming into contact with the sensitive tissues. By using eye drops that contain hydroxypropylmethylcellulose, individuals can reduce their risk of developing eye infections and other complications.

Furthermore, hydroxypropylmethylcellulose is known for its ability to improve the retention time of eye drops on the surface of the eye. This means that the medication in the eye drops stays in contact with the eye for a longer period of time, allowing for better absorption and effectiveness. This is particularly important for individuals who require frequent use of eye drops for conditions such as glaucoma or cataracts.

Another benefit of hydroxypropylmethylcellulose in eye drops is its compatibility with contact lenses. Many individuals who wear contact lenses experience dryness and discomfort, especially towards the end of the day. By using eye drops that contain hydroxypropylmethylcellulose, individuals can help alleviate these symptoms and improve their overall comfort while wearing contact lenses.

Applications of Hydroxypropylmethylcellulose in Food Industry

Hydroxypropylmethylcellulose, also known as HPMC, is a versatile ingredient that has found numerous applications in the food industry. This compound is derived from cellulose, a natural polymer found in plants, and is widely used as a thickening agent, emulsifier, and stabilizer in various food products.

One of the key properties of hydroxypropylmethylcellulose is its ability to form a gel-like consistency when mixed with water. This makes it an ideal ingredient for thickening soups, sauces, and gravies, as well as for creating creamy textures in dairy products such as ice cream and yogurt. In addition, HPMC can also be used to improve the shelf life of food products by preventing moisture loss and maintaining their freshness.

Another important application of hydroxypropylmethylcellulose in the food industry is as an emulsifier. Emulsifiers are substances that help to stabilize mixtures of oil and water, preventing them from separating. HPMC can be used to create stable emulsions in products such as salad dressings, mayonnaise, and margarine, giving them a smooth and creamy texture.

In addition to its thickening and emulsifying properties, hydroxypropylmethylcellulose is also used as a stabilizer in a wide range of food products. Stabilizers help to maintain the texture and consistency of food products, preventing them from breaking down or separating over time. HPMC can be used to stabilize products such as canned fruits and vegetables, bakery items, and frozen desserts, ensuring that they remain fresh and appealing to consumers.

One of the key advantages of using hydroxypropylmethylcellulose in the food industry is its versatility. This compound is compatible with a wide range of ingredients and can be used in both hot and cold applications. It is also heat-stable, meaning that it can withstand high temperatures without losing its thickening or stabilizing properties. This makes HPMC an ideal ingredient for a variety of food products, from baked goods to frozen desserts.

Hydroxypropylmethylcellulose as a Sustainable Building Material

Hydroxypropylmethylcellulose, also known as HPMC, is a versatile and sustainable building material that has gained popularity in the construction industry in recent years. This compound is derived from cellulose, a natural polymer found in plants, and is commonly used as a thickening agent, binder, and film-former in various applications. In the construction sector, HPMC is valued for its ability to improve the performance and durability of building materials while also reducing environmental impact.

One of the key advantages of using hydroxypropylmethylcellulose in construction is its eco-friendly nature. As a plant-based material, HPMC is biodegradable and non-toxic, making it a more sustainable alternative to synthetic chemicals commonly used in building products. By incorporating HPMC into construction materials, builders can reduce their carbon footprint and contribute to a more environmentally friendly building industry.

In addition to its environmental benefits, hydroxypropylmethylcellulose offers a range of practical advantages for construction projects. HPMC can improve the workability and consistency of cement-based materials, such as mortar and grout, by acting as a water retention agent. This helps to prevent premature drying and cracking, resulting in stronger and more durable structures. HPMC can also enhance the adhesion and cohesion of building materials, improving their overall performance and longevity.

Furthermore, hydroxypropylmethylcellulose is highly versatile and can be customized to meet specific project requirements. By adjusting the molecular weight, degree of substitution, and other properties of HPMC, builders can tailor the material to achieve desired characteristics, such as viscosity, setting time, and strength. This flexibility makes HPMC suitable for a wide range of construction applications, from plastering and tiling to waterproofing and insulation.
